Exhaust studs and nuts may be loose
Defect Summary
Mitsubishi fuso truck of america, inc. (mfta) is recalling certain 2019-2021 fec7t, feczt, fec9t vehicles. the exhaust pipe studs and nuts may not have been properly tightened.
Safety Consequence
Loose exhaust mounting can result in hot exhaust gases leaking, increasing the risk of a fire.
Corrective Action
Mfta will notify owners, and dealers will tighten the exhaust studs and nuts to the correct torque specification. the recall began december 11, 2020. owners may contact mfta customer service at 1-877-711-0707. mfta's number for this recall is c10114.

What is recall 20V646000?
NHTSA recall 20V646000 was issued by Mitsubishi Fuso Truck Of America, Inc. on October 19, 2020. It addresses: Exhaust studs and nuts may be loose. The recall affects approximately 4,294 vehicles, with the defect involving the Engine And Engine Cooling component.
How do I get this recall repaired?
Contact any authorized Mitsubishi Fuso Truck Of America, Inc. dealer and reference NHTSA recall ID 20V646000 or the manufacturer campaign number C10114. Under federal law, the repair is completely free regardless of vehicle age or owner history.

How long do I have to get a recall repair done?
There is no expiration on most federal safety recalls. Even if your vehicle is years old and you bought it used, the manufacturer is required to perform the repair at no cost.
